HV2708T-C/R8X Details

  • Manufacturer Part Number:

    HV2708T-C/R8X

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Pin Count:

    48

  • Manufacturer Package Code:

    LQFP-48

  • Country Of Origin:

    Taiwan

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.39.00.01

  • Factory Lead Time:

    7 Weeks

  • Manufacturer:

    Microchip Technology Inc

  • YTEOL:

    19

  • Additional Feature:

    ALSO REQUIRES 4.5 TO 6.3 V SUPPLY

  • Analog IC - Other Type:

    SPDT

  • Input Voltage-Max:

    100 V

  • Input Voltage-Min:

    -100 V

  • JESD-30 Code:

    S-PQFP-G48

  • JESD-609 Code:

    e3

  • Length:

    7 mm

  • Neg Supply Voltage-Max (Vsup):

    -6.3 V

  • Neg Supply Voltage-Min (Vsup):

    -4.5 V

  • Number of Channels:

    16

  • Number of Functions:

    1

  • Number of Terminals:

    48

  • Off-state Isolation-Nom:

    64 dB

  • On-state Resistance Match-Nom:

    5.75 Ω

  • On-state Resistance-Max (Ron):

    23 Ω

  • Operating Temperature-Max:

    70 °C

  • Output:

    SEPARATE OUTPUT

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Code:

    LFQFP

  • Package Equivalence Code:

    QFP48,.35SQ,20

  • Package Shape:

    SQUARE

  • Package Style:

    FLATPACK, LOW PROFILE, FINE PITCH

  • Seated Height-Max:

    1.6 mm

  • Signal Current-Max:

    0.5 A

  • Supply Current-Max (Isup):

    0.5 mA

  • Supply Voltage-Max (Vsup):

    5.5 V

  • Supply Voltage-Min (Vsup):

    3 V

  • Supply Voltage-Nom (Vsup):

    5 V

  • Surface Mount:

    YES

  • Switch-off Time-Max:

    5000 ns

  • Switch-on Time-Max:

    5000 ns

  • Temperature Grade:

    COMMERCIAL

  • Terminal Finish:

    Matte Tin (Sn)

  • Terminal Form:

    GULL WING

  • Terminal Pitch:

    0.5 mm

  • Terminal Position:

    QUAD

  • Width:

    7 mm

About Microchip

Microchip Technology Inc. is a leading manufacturer of microcontrollers and semiconductor devices for a wide range of applications in the aerospace, automotive, consumer electronics, industrial, and medical industries. Alongside a comprehensive product portfolio, Microchip Technology Inc. also provides easy-to-use development tools that enable engineers to create optimal designs quickly with minimal iterations to reduce risk while lowering total system costs to market.
